Great digs in DC
The location of this hotel is great for people wanting to visit the major monuments and museums of DC. The manager is from Trinidad and loves to chat. Everything is within 15 minutes casual walk. The metro is just 1 block away, giving you options further afield. There are lots of (cheap) eating places within walking distance, as well as fancier places eating and shopping places within 2 blocks. Theres also a cheap souvenir shop at 1000 F St. The only downside is some panhandlers around- but you can assuage your conscience by buying them a meal with the money you save staying here.

Friendly and helpful staff, clean, great location!
The Red Roof Inn Washington, DC Downtown is a good place to stay. It is a short walk to the Washington Mall, and there is a very nice Safeway grocery store four blocks away that has a deli with lots of good food. Our room was decent and a resonable price for being in the center of DC. We bought food from the Safeway and enjoyed not having to leave any tips. The parking was full at the RR Inn when we arrived, so we parked at the garage under the Verizon Center one block away and that was just fine. The only bad thing I can say is that the bedside radio got poor reception and it was just a lousy radio. The staff were friendly and I would stay there again.
